Please explain in the area below why an STA is necessary:
We will be transmitting with GSM-900, GSM-1800, and UMTS phones.
The Testing will be performed inside a plane during taxi and in a hanger.
- For GSM-900 - transmit power is 250 milliwatts, uplink Tx frequencies are 890.2 - 914.8 MHz, downlink Rx frequencies are 935 - 960 MHz, channel separation is 200 KHz (124 channels total), our test would require only a single channel - proposed as 902.4 MHz (midband), distance between up- and down-link is 45 MHz
- For GSM-1800- transmit power is 125 milliwatts, uplink Tx frequencies are 1710.2 - 1785.0 MHz, channel separation is 200 KHz, test would require only a single channel - proposed as 1747.8 MHz (midband), distance between up- and down-link is 45 MHz
- For UMTS, transmit power is 24 dBm, uplink Tx frequencies are 1920 - 2170 MHz, channel separation is 200 KHz, our proposed test channel will be between 1930-1980 MHz, distance between up- and down-link is 190 MHz.
US Airways Engineering Department is performing studies to access the impact of wireless devices on the aircraft. Testing will be performed at airports CLT (9/14 and 9/15) and PHL (9/21 and 9/22).
